How to Determine if Your Driver’s License Is Valid
To check if your driver’s license is still valid, follow the steps outlined above. Generally, a driver's license is considered valid or in force if it meets all the following requirements:
- It has not expired.
- It has not been suspended or revoked.
- It is issued in your current state of residence.
- You have it in your possession while driving.
- You have completed any necessary driving-related exams, screenings, or requirements.
